Essential Aspects of Coffee Bean Preservation

Effective packaging protects coffee beans from several destructive elements:

  • Oxygen exposure that can rapidly degrade flavor
  • Moisture that leads to potential mold growth
  • Light that breaks down delicate aromatic compounds
  • Temperature fluctuations that compromise bean quality

Advanced Materials Revolutionizing Coffee Packaging

Specialized materials are changing how coffee beans are protected during storage and transportation. Multilayer barrier films with high-performance polymers create an exceptional shield against oxygen, moisture, and light – the primary enemies of coffee freshness.

Coffee bag valves play a crucial role in this innovative packaging ecosystem. These one-way degassing valves allow carbon dioxide to escape while preventing external air from entering, maintaining optimal bean quality. The strategic placement of coffee bag valves ensures that roasted beans can naturally release gases without compromising package integrity.

Degassing valves have become a standard feature in premium coffee packaging, allowing roasters to seal packages immediately after roasting. These sophisticated valves prevent package swelling while maintaining the beans’ optimal flavor profile.

How important is roast date labeling in coffee packaging?

Roast date labeling is critically important for consumers who prioritize freshness. It provides transparency, helps customers understand the optimal consumption window, and demonstrates the roaster’s commitment to quality. Most specialty coffee experts recommend consuming beans within 2-4 weeks of the roast date for optimal flavor.

What role do one-way degassing valves play in coffee packaging?

One-way degassing valves are critical in coffee packaging as they allow carbon dioxide (released by freshly roasted beans) to escape without letting oxygen enter the package. This prevents package inflation and helps maintain the beans’ optimal flavor profile by managing internal gas pressure during the post-roast degassing process.
